Step 1: Cleanse

Starting from a clean base is important for every skincare routine and every skin type. Imagine your skin down at the microscopic level. Look at all that dirt and grime. Now, imagine it mixing with products.

Step 2: Tone

A good toner removes any dirt or grime that your cleanser left behind. However, for those with dry skin, this is a step that you should probably avoid as toners tend to be drying. Step 3: Moisturize

We consider moisturization to be the ultimate, most important thing you could ever do for your skin. Drinking water is extremely important for hydration, but even then, we need to add moisture topically.

Lookie here!! Key tip

Our final recommendation for the day is to patch-test every product for at least a week, to look for any adverse reactions. Introduce each product one at a time so that your skin isn’t shocked by the sudden introduction of a variety of products.
